Research   
BNR

The Centre’s mix of pilot-scale facilities, real-time access to waste streams, and close linkages to researchers allows for a holistic approach to research & development. Opportunities for R&D cover a wide scope of waste management activities—from waste to energy systems to industrial process and effluent monitoring. Our services include these core areas:


Piloting

Facilities at both the Solid Waste Research & Development Facility and the Wastewater Research and Training Centre have been designed specifically for scale-up of novel technologies from bench- to pilot-scale using process streams from actual, full-scale operations.



Research Consultation

The Centre has close linkages to researchers at the University of Alberta and the Alberta Research Council. This enables the Centre to identify and assemble powerful teams to address research needs and problems across the whole spectrum of waste management. Assistance is available in problem definition, preparation of grant applications, project management and report preparation.
